网络安全是当今数字化时代的重要议题,随着互联网的普及和技术的快速发展,网络威胁也日益复杂和多样化。本文将深入探讨网络安全的基本概念、常用策略以及如何应对各种网络威胁。

一、网络安全的基本概念

1.1 网络安全定义

网络安全是指保护网络系统不受未经授权的访问、攻击、破坏和干扰,确保网络数据的完整性、保密性和可用性。

1.2 网络安全面临的威胁

网络安全面临的威胁主要包括:

  • 恶意软件:如病毒、木马、蠕虫等。
  • 网络攻击:如拒绝服务攻击(DoS)、分布式拒绝服务攻击(DDoS)等。
  • 信息泄露:如数据泄露、隐私泄露等。
  • 网络钓鱼:通过伪装成合法网站或机构,诱骗用户输入敏感信息。

二、常用网络安全策略

2.1 防火墙技术

防火墙是网络安全的第一道防线,它可以监控和控制进出网络的流量,防止恶意攻击。

# 示例:Python代码实现简单的防火墙规则
def firewall_rule(packet):
    # 检查数据包是否符合安全规则
    if packet['source'] in ['192.168.1.1', '192.168.1.2']:
        return True  # 允许
    else:
        return False  # 拒绝

# 模拟数据包
packet = {'source': '192.168.1.3', 'destination': '192.168.1.1', 'type': 'HTTP'}
print(firewall_rule(packet))  # 输出:False

2.2 入侵检测系统(IDS)

入侵检测系统可以实时监控网络流量,发现并报警潜在的安全威胁。

2.3 安全漏洞扫描

定期进行安全漏洞扫描,发现并修复系统中的漏洞,降低被攻击的风险。

2.4 数据加密

对敏感数据进行加密,确保数据在传输和存储过程中的安全性。

2.5 安全意识培训

提高员工的安全意识,避免因人为因素导致的安全事故。

三、应对网络威胁的策略

3.1 及时更新系统和软件

定期更新操作系统、应用程序和驱动程序,修复已知的安全漏洞。

3.2 使用强密码策略

采用复杂密码,并定期更换密码,降低密码被破解的风险。

3.3 实施访问控制

根据用户角色和权限,限制对敏感信息的访问。

3.4 建立应急响应机制

制定应急预案,一旦发生安全事件,能够迅速响应并采取措施。

四、总结

网络安全是保障信息化社会稳定和发展的关键。了解网络安全的基本概念、常用策略和应对网络威胁的方法,有助于我们更好地应对各种网络威胁,保护个人信息和财产安全。